Software component - 3SE

Draft

https://www.3se.info/3se-onto/terms/software-component-3se-069b85f238e370c5

Functionally distinct part of a software, composed of at least one software unit, and which exposes at least one software component interface.

Relations

Relatedsoftware-component-req-3se-069c3bf770d271d6  ·  software-component-validation-3se-069c3bf770f17c85  ·  software-architecture-3se-069cfeb60f46731b  ·  software-breakdown-structure-3se-069dc076d3b77fa1  ·  software-component-breakdown-structure-3se-069dc076d3dc7c81  ·  software-component-function-3se-069dc076d3e579da  ·  software-interface-breakdown-structure-3se-069dc11873027025
Composed ofsoftware-unit-3se-069b85f238eb7572
Allocatessoftware-component-state-3se-069dc11872f97625
Exposessoftware-component-interface-3se-069dc11872d97b8a
Narrow matchsoftware-component-24765-2017-069a99c8f72b7271

JSON-LD

{
  "@context": "https://www.3se.info/3se-onto/contexts/term.context.jsonld",
  "@type": "skos:Concept",
  "title": "Software component - 3SE",
  "description": "Functionally distinct part of a software, composed of at least one software unit, and which exposes at least one software component interface.",
  "status": "draft",
  "narrowMatch": [
    "https://www.3se.info/3se-onto/terms/software-component-24765-2017-069a99c8f72b7271"
  ],
  "isComposedOf": [
    "https://www.3se.info/3se-onto/terms/software-unit-3se-069b85f238eb7572"
  ],
  "@id": "https://www.3se.info/3se-onto/terms/software-component-3se-069b85f238e370c5",
  "entryCreated": "2026-03-16",
  "entryModified": "2026-04-12",
  "entryCreator": {
    "@type": "foaf:Person",
    "name": "@rcasteran"
  },
  "related": [
    "https://www.3se.info/3se-onto/terms/software-component-req-3se-069c3bf770d271d6",
    "https://www.3se.info/3se-onto/terms/software-component-validation-3se-069c3bf770f17c85",
    "https://www.3se.info/3se-onto/terms/software-architecture-3se-069cfeb60f46731b",
    "https://www.3se.info/3se-onto/terms/software-breakdown-structure-3se-069dc076d3b77fa1",
    "https://www.3se.info/3se-onto/terms/software-component-breakdown-structure-3se-069dc076d3dc7c81",
    "https://www.3se.info/3se-onto/terms/software-component-function-3se-069dc076d3e579da",
    "https://www.3se.info/3se-onto/terms/software-interface-breakdown-structure-3se-069dc11873027025"
  ],
  "allocates": [
    "https://www.3se.info/3se-onto/terms/software-component-state-3se-069dc11872f97625"
  ],
  "exposes": [
    "https://www.3se.info/3se-onto/terms/software-component-interface-3se-069dc11872d97b8a"
  ]
}

Raw JSON-LD: index.jsonld

Created 2026-03-16  ·  Modified 2026-04-12  ·  by @rcasteran